Their relationship comes more than a year after Williams married indie musicianPhil Elverumduring the summer of 2018. The two quietly separated in early 2019, but theDawson’s Creekalum toldVanity Fairshortly after they married that their relationship provided the “radical acceptance” she had been searching for since her romance with the lateHeath Ledger, who was Matilda’s father.
“I never gave up on love,” Williams said toVanity Fair. “I always say to Matilda, ‘Your dad loved me before anybody thought I was talented, or pretty, or had nice clothes.’ ”
